Kupfer, Adol'f IAkovlevich, 1799-1865.
Adol'f Kupfer papers.
Includes documents related to Kupfer's scientific activity; for instance, his project on the introducing of the metallic airmeters; notes by Kupfer and B. S. (M. H.) Jakobi on the alcoholmeter; "On Ventilation" (journals of the Committee formed for the considering of various types of ventilation and a booklet on the ventilation methods abroad); papers concerning the formation of the Physical Observatory; some papers on resistance and elasticity of metals; notes about joining the railway elements and about the use of passage tools for checking the clocks; materials from Kupfer's ethnographic studies of Kalmyks, Voguls and Caucasian tribes; and correspondence with A. v. Humbolt and that related to expedition to Sea of Okhotsk. Some drafts and rough copies.
Russian scholar (research on crystallography and terrestrial magnetism, influence of heat on elasticity of metals). Studied under Ha y (Paris, France); professor chemistry, physics, and mineralogy, University Kasan (Russia), 1824-1828; employed by government to explore Urals, Russia, 1828; professor, School of Bridges and Highways, also Pedagogical School; later director Central Observatory Physics. Founder, Bureau Meteorology, 1843; also director; recipient Berlin Academy prize, 1826. Member Academy of Science, St. Petersburg.
